DESCRIPTION:Back in the foggy dawn of computer science it was believed tha
 t if we could develop minimalistic models of computation we could understa
 nd much more about computability. Obviously this is not the case\, so we a
 re left with some very confusing systems.\n\nThis talk covers a few of tho
 se systems and the programming languages they spawned: brainfuck\, Lazy K 
 and BCP. The talk will also cover other esoteric langauges: Conway's Game 
 of Life and Bitwise Cyclic Tag\, with a few honourable mentions that fail 
 to be Turing tar-pits (Whitespace and Ndef to name two).\n\nThe talk will 
 give an overview of each language and computational model introduced\, att
 empting for each to show how it works\, how it's weird\, and why it exists
 .\n\nThis talk is an introduction to the world of esoteric languages\, beg
 inning with those special ones for which anything is possible but nothing 
 is easy.\n
